Negatively Skewed Distribution Example. Note that left skewed distributions are sometimes called negatively-skewed distributions and right skewed distributions are sometimes called positively-skewed distributions. Skewness is positive. A distribution is negatively skewed if it has a tail on the left side of the distribution. As a general rule when data is skewed to the right positively skewed the mean will be greater than the median.
